How to Exit Apple TV App?

Using Apple TV to exit an app is simple. You can choose to close apps manually or you can force quit them. This is useful when an app is not performing as expected.

If your app is not working properly, or you are running out of space, you may want to close it. This will help protect your TV’s performance. It will also free up space.

You can do this by using the Siri Remote. It has a touchpad on the top and a clickpad on the bottom. You can use the touchpad to scroll through your open apps. You can then swipe up on the selected app to close it.

You can also force quit your apps with the Apple TV remote. The Siri Remote has a Back button that will close any apps that are not responding. You can then return to the Home screen by pressing the Back button on the Siri Remote.

You can also choose to use the Control Center menu to close an app. This is similar to the App Switcher.

How Do I Close All Open Apps Instantly?

Several models of the Apple TV allow you to close all open apps instantly. Some models have multitasking, which allows you to switch from one app to another, while others don’t. However, no matter what model you have, you can close all of your open apps in a few simple steps.

If you have a 3rd generation model of the Apple TV, you can do so by holding the Menu button on the remote. Once you press the Menu button, you can exit the multitasking mode and return to the Home screen.

On an earlier model of the Apple TV, you can use the remote touchpad to close the app. Just swipe upward on the touchpad until the app you want to shut down is at the top of the stack. After closing the app, the sound will stop. If the app is a video app, the video will not play.

Where is Control Center on Apple TV App?

Using the Control Center feature on Apple TV makes it easier to manage your media. The feature allows you to put your Apple TV to sleep, turn it off, and more. You can also change settings and switch user accounts. You can customize the Control Center to add additional controls.

The Control Center appears in the right hand corner of the TV screen. You can access it from any app. It’s very similar to the Control Center on your iPad. The feature has been updated in recent years. In tvOS 13, the Control Center included quick-access toggles for features like system sleep.
